I unfortunately must rely on the written word, specifically Jim’s web-site in order to judge the merits of his candidacy for U.S. Senate as I have not heard him speak in person.

Jim presents the every man story on his web-site, at some point while minding his own business the Politicians got side tracked and are no longer doing what they are supposed to be doing, and now that they made him “mad enough” he wants to go to Washington and correct the problems.

I do not necessarily agree on equalizing the Tax Burden, however I am sure that if he and I were to have a conversation we probably agree that the current Tax Burden is the highest on the Upper Middle Class and that it should be equalized between all those that can afford it.

I firmly agree that everyone graduating High School should do Federal Service, however I think that goes beyond Military Service, the Peace Corps, the Freedom Corps, and other organizations are just as important. And the reward should be the training required to be a productive citizen in the U.S., if you want to be a Auto Mechanic than your training should move you down that road.

If Jim gives an awe inspiring speech at the State Convention I will be more than willing to support his candidacy with my first vote; however as it stands he will be my second Choice.
